CABIN
FEVER
(2003)

Five college friends
rent out a cabin in the woods for a week. The plan is
simple - drinking drugs
& sex. Sound familiar? Anyway, the group
encounters a seriously
diseased man who is just looking for help, but his
disgusting appearance
causes the kids to push him away. When he attempts to
take their truck, the
kids beat him and set him afire. In the process, the
truck (their only way
out) is trashed. And now, they're terrified that the
man's disease might
have been passed to them. And soon enough, it is.
I enjoyed this movie
a lot. It's nothing really new, but it seemed fresh.
The "horror" comes from
the disease itself - some sort of flesh eating
virus, which allows
the special effects guys to come up with some gross
rotting skin effects.
The big thing that stands out for me in this film is
that they're able to
include good (and bizarre) humor without compromising
the suspense.
There are some freaky redneck characters in this movie,
including the mulleted
kid Dennis, who you shouldn't sit next to. And
Winston, the young cop
always looking for a party. And "Grim" the skater
dude with a pocket full
of pot. There are some laugh out loud funny scenes,
but there are also some
truly scary and suspenseful sequences. This movie
held my interest the
whole way through. It's not a ground breaking movie,
or one that has an underlying
purpose or statement (at least that I could
notice), but it was
a fun, scary, interesting movie.
